  • Patent number: 5063973
    Abstract: In a weft detecting device, optical fiber bundles, lenses, a light emitting module, a light receiving module, and an amplifier are integrated in a thin detecting sensor body having substantially the same shape of that of reed dent so that the device can be fitted in the narrow space between the reed dents of an air jet loom.

  • Patent number: 4781832
    Abstract: Disclosed is a hollow-fiber filter module having a novel structure in which a large number of hollow fibers for filtration use are disposed in a rectilinear fashion, two exit planes are defined by the opposite open ends of the hollow fibers, a filtrate collection chamber is formed over one of the exit planes, and one or more filtrate conduits are provided in order to conduct the filtrate collected in the filtrate collection chamber to the other exit plane. A reinforcing ring helps secure the filtrate conduits. This hollow-fiber filter module permits the efficient utilization of a hollow-fiber filter membrane and, therefore, can reduce the space occupied by the module. Moreover, a plurality of such hollow-fiber filter modules can be connected in series and used in the form of a hollow-fiber filter module assembly having a length of several meters.

  • Patent number: 4605500
    Abstract: The present invention discloses a hollow-fiber filter module comprising (a) an annular member, (b) a filter membrane consisting of a large number of hollow fibers, (c) a fastening member attached to the inside surface of the annular member for bundling and fixing the hollow fibers in a U-shaped pattern with their both ends left open, (d) a supporting member consisting of a plurality of supporting pillars or a cylinder, said supporting member being joined to said annular member and extending along the U-shaped portions of the hollow fibers, and (e) a hollow fiber retaining member joined to the supporting member and extending through the space enclosed in the U-shaped portions of the hollow fibers. This hollow-fiber filter module is suitable for use in water purifiers for treating large volumes of water containing minute colloidal particles and can be efficiently regenerated by gas bubble treatment to restore its filtering function.

  • Patent number: 4025279
    Abstract: An apparatus for producing composite structure fibers is disclosed which includes an upper distribution plate provided with plural slits for making at least two spinning components into independent thin layer streams, a lower distribution plate provided with plural fine holes for dividing each of said thin layer streams into plural fine capillary streams independent from each other and a spinneret plate provided with a bundling space and extrusion orifices for bundling said previously divided fine capillary streams and extruding them into filaments, said upper distribution plate, lower distribution plate and spinneret plate being piled up in this order.
